Basement Drainage Installation in Providence, RI
Basement drainage installation services involve setting up systems that help manage excess water around a property’s foundation, preventing potential flooding and water damage. These projects typically include installing interior or exterior drainage solutions such as sump pumps, French drains, or drainage tiles to redirect water away from the basement area. Property owners often request this service when experiencing persistent dampness, flooding during heavy rains, or concerns about moisture seeping through basement walls, aiming to protect their homes and maintain a dry, stable environment.
Before requesting basement drainage installation, homeowners should consider the existing condition of their foundation and drainage systems, as well as the history of water issues in the area. Understanding the property’s landscape, soil type, and water flow patterns can help determine the most effective drainage solutions. It’s also helpful to know whether any existing drainage systems require upgrades or repairs, ensuring the installation addresses current problems and provides long-term protection against water intrusion.

Common Basement Drainage Installation Jobs
Basement Drainage Systems - Installing effective drainage solutions to prevent water buildup and flooding.
Foundation Drainage - Enhancing soil drainage around the foundation to reduce moisture intrusion.
Interior Drainage Channels - Creating interior channels to divert water away from basement walls.
Egress Window Drains - Installing drainage systems around egress windows to manage seepage.
Slope and Grading Adjustments - Improving yard slope to direct surface water away from the basement.
Drainage Pipe Installation - Laying underground pipes to carry water safely away from the property.
Basement Drainage Installation Questions
What is basement drainage installation? It involves setting up systems to direct water away from a basement to prevent flooding and water damage.
Why is proper drainage important for basements? Effective drainage helps keep basements dry, reduces mold growth, and protects property foundations.
What types of drainage systems are commonly installed? Common options include interior drain tiles, exterior footing drains, and sump pump systems.
How can I tell if my basement needs drainage improvements? Signs include damp walls, water stains, musty odors, or frequent flooding after heavy rain.
